First Born Child

How should I adjust my (and my spouse') W4 when our son is born? Does it impact taxes for the entire year and are there any deductions that I should look to take advantage of that may or may not be well know.

Thanks for the question. You may want to fill out a new W4 once your son is born. Step 3 of the W4 has a post for you to list dependent children under age 17. This should reduce your withholdings slightly to account for the Child Tax Credit you will receive on your return from that year forward. It's not necessary that you do this, your refund may be slightly higher on Tax Day. Keep in mind that filing a new W4 could change any other selections you have made in previous W4s so you may want to ask for a copy of the old one from your payroll department.
